How many apps do you have starting at boot? Stop the ones that are not needed
to start at boot or not essential and which you can start when needed.

Delete any shortcuts in the Startup folder on the Start > Programs menu.
Check each apps options for settings that enable/disable the app starting at
boot.
Click Start > Run, type in: regedit and press Enter.
Expand hklm\software\microsoft\windows\current version and check the registry
RUN keys. Delete any entries in the right pane not needed, but not before
exporting the key/s in case something was needed and you need to merge the key
back.
